A. While lenders have the legal right to bring a lawsuit for non-payment of a financial debt obligation; such lawsuits are much less common than the majority of people assume. It sets you back money to sue someone, and also a lawful judgment is merely a piece of paper unless there is a way to gather cash against it. The danger of litigation, on the other hand, is all also typical, despite the fact that debt collectors are not meant to threaten lawful activity unless they are particularly licensed to bring fit. In general, legal actions can normally be stayed clear of, provided you are ready to work out appropriate arrangements with your creditors via the negotiation procedure.

Financial organizations are required to report canceled financial obligations over $600 (the portion forgiven throughout the negotiation deals) to the Internal Revenue Service, as well as the borrower is needed to report that as revenue on their tax return. Nevertheless, the Internal Revenue Service allows you to balance out any kind of "earnings" from canceled debts approximately the amount you were "financially troubled" at the time the financial obligations were canceled. You are "financially troubled" if you owe more than you possess, or simply put, if you have an adverse total assets.
